What is the difference between Internship Work vs Data Analyst?

AspectInternship WorkData Analyst
Required CredentialsUsually students or recent graduates, some technical skillsBachelor's degree in data science, statistics, or related field; some roles prefer certifications
Work EnvironmentTemporary, learning-focused, often part-time or project-basedFull-time, professional setting, ongoing responsibilities
Employer & Industry UsageInternships offered across industries for training purposesData-driven roles in various industries like finance, marketing, healthcare
Comparison Search IntentUnderstanding entry-level opportunities and learning rolesSeeking professional data analysis roles and career progression

Internship Work provides hands-on experience for students or recent graduates, focusing on learning and skill development. Data Analysts are professionals responsible for analyzing data to inform business decisions. While internships are temporary and educational, data analyst roles are ongoing positions requiring specific skills and experience.

What jobs do internship work do?

Internship work involves temporary positions that provide practical experience in a specific field, such as marketing, engineering, or finance. Interns typically assist with tasks like research, data analysis, or project support, gaining skills and industry knowledge while often working under supervision during a set schedule. These roles can lead to full-time employment opportunities and help develop professional competencies.
